5.11 Emergency power supply
If all alarm messages have been ignored, up to the 
point where the batteries are completely discharged, 
it will no longer be possible to operate the compo-
nents. All functions are locked, the only signal is for 
'empty' batteries (acoustic signal 1 x 3s). 
The following actuators may still be opened with the 
Programmer and the emergency power supply.
• c-lever
• TouchGo c-lever
Behaviour of actuators during emergency power sup-
ply:
• actuator remains open
• 'Emergency power supply' event in Trace-
back 
• TimePro is not evaluated.
 
The emergency power supply is only possible 
once the battery signal is showing 'empty'.
For access authorisations with time settings 
and CardLink, always replace the batteries for 
the actuators and set the clock precisely fol-
lowing emergency power supply. 
1. Open settings menu. (See Chapter 5.2.)  
2. Select Emergency power supply in the sub-
menu and confirm using the ENTER key.
3. Connect the programming cable and press 
the ENTER key.  
4. The Programmer action is displayed.
